Spot copyright Money Test?
Have you ever wondered if you could spot copyright money? It's a skill that can be surprisingly easy to learn. While there are no foolproof methods, there are some helpful clues that can increase your chances of exposing fake bills.
- Inspect the paper quality. Counterfeiters often use lower-quality stock that feels different to the touch.
- Observe for security elements. Genuine bills have embedded threads and watermarks that are difficult to imitate.
- Stroke the raised printing. Legitimate currency has textured ink on certain areas.
Remember, if you suspect a bill is copyright, it's best to turn in it to the authorities immediately.
